Q: Is 45,759,831 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 45,759,831 is a composite number.

Why is 45,759,831 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 45,759,831 can be evenly divided by 1 3 13 39 73 219 949 2,847 16,073 48,219 208,949 626,847 1,173,329 3,519,987 15,253,277 and 45,759,831, with no remainder.

Since 45,759,831 cannot be divided by just 1 and 45,759,831, it is a composite number.
